πŸ“‹ Key Responsibilities

βœ… Create and translate marketing & product materials for internal and external audiences

βœ… Assist in marketing and advertising promotional activities (e.g., social media, direct mail, and web)

βœ… Distribute collateral, giveaways, and promotional materials to the sales team

βœ… Assist in preparations for tradeshows, events, and product launches

βœ… Conduct research on target audiences and present new campaign ideas for social media promotion

βœ… Support internal administrative work

βœ… Other tasks as assigned by the supervisor
